B
Bivina Sunny 
M.A. in History - Batch of 2023
4
4Placements4Infrastructure4Faculty4Crowd & Campus Life4Value for Money
My review of this college.
Placements: Don't have much of a clue. Because for my course, there are very rare chances for placement and job opportunities just within or on the completion of the Bachelor's. You can apply to private and government organisations like ASI, National Museum, UNHRC, Ministry of External Affairs, etc., for placement. For other courses like B.Com, I can say there are good packages. Our college offers placement and internships for students. The staff will help you with all this. They will teach you how to represent yourself in an interview. The average salary package is 2.1 LPA, the maximum package went to 18 LPA.
Infrastructure: The course is very good, and you also get an honours degree, which is very important. The course combines different subjects such as reading Gandhi, English, geography, political science, etc. Thus, you get to learn different subjects in a single course. The hostel is really good. There isn't any AC. But the food is also really good. It's difficult to get a hostel, though, you only get it if you are an outstanding student. The hostel has all the facilities. Like the mess, playground, etc., the bathroom of the hostel is very hygienic. Boys and girls have separate hostels. The girls' hostel is a little costly.
Faculty: The faculty members are good and cooperative. They help all the students. I believe we have the best faculty in terms of our course. Teachers are highly experienced. They provide excellent lectures and notes. Their explanation of the topics is the best. Teachers clear the doubts as well. The exam structure is according to the credit-based system, which was a grading system in which 25 marks were for the internal and 75 marks for the exam. There was also a regular class test, and an assignment was provided by the professors to the students. The exam went very smoothly and was under proper operation.
